Another Porac frontliner is Covid-positive

PORAC -- Another healthcare worker from Barangay Poblacion here tested positive for the coronavirus, according to a report of the municipal government.

The patient is an intensive care unit nurse in a private hospital in Angeles City, who had been a close contact of a patient who has also tested positive for coronavirus. The patient had notified the local government and went into self-isolation.

The municipal government had difficulty securing an isolation facility for the patient due to the number of coronavirus cases in the province, which has stretched the capacity of isolation facilities and hospital facilities.

The patient began manifesting symptoms on August 3. The patient was finally given a slot for swab testing on August 5. The results came out positive on August 8. The patient had been designated into a healthcare facility.

The municipal government had placed three other close contacts under isolation and are now awaiting swab testing.

This town had recorded ten coronavirus cases since the start of the pandemic. Four cases have since recovered while another had died. Five cases are still active and are admitted in various healthcare facilities.
